13Years Old

Enrolled at exclusive Lakeside School private preparatory in 1968; school acquired Teletype terminal linked to computer, sparking lifelong passion for programming; taught himself BASIC, wrote first programs including tic-tac-toe; befriended older student Paul Allen and formed Lakeside Programmers Club.

14Years Old

Deepened programming at Lakeside; exploited system bugs for extra computer time (initially banned, then allowed for testing); collaborated with friends on school projects.

15Years Old

Continued intense computer work at Lakeside; automated class scheduling system with Paul Allen; excused from some classes to pursue programming.

16Years Old

Ongoing Lakeside studies; explored commercial programming opportunities; collaborated with Paul Allen and others on early software ventures.

17Years Old

Co-founded Traf-O-Data with Paul Allen to process traffic data using Intel 8008; served as congressional page in U.S. House; graduated Lakeside as National Merit Scholar with near-perfect 1590/1600 SAT score.

18Years Old

Enrolled at Harvard University pre-law but focused on math and computer science; took advanced courses including Math 55; met future Microsoft executive Steve Ballmer.

19Years Old

Continued Harvard studies; published pancake sorting algorithm with professor; spent summer working with Paul Allen at Honeywell; closely followed microcomputer developments.

20Years Old

Dropped out of Harvard in 1975 to co-found Microsoft with Paul Allen after seeing Altair 8800 in Popular Electronics; developed BASIC interpreter; moved operations to Albuquerque near MITS.
